The hexadecimal color code #4B3996 corresponds to the code RGB( 75, 57, 150 ). It's a shade of Blue. This color is a combination of red (at 0,29 level), green (at 0,22 level) and blue (at 0,59 level). Its brightness is 40% and its saturation is 44%. It is composed of red at 26%, green at 20% and blue at 53%.
